Telephone conversation with Tajikistan President Emomali Rahmon

    In the morning of 5 October Belarus President Aleksandr Lukashenko had a telephone conversation with Tajikistan President Emomali Rahmon. The two leaders disused the current state and prospects of bilateral relations.

    The heads of state pointed out the interest in the further enactment of Belarus-Tajikistan cooperation. Special attention was drawn to the trade and economy, including to interaction in the manufacturing sector and agriculture, organization of the delivery of equipment to Tajikistan.

    The presidents also discussed the interaction of the two countries on the international arena and the schedule of future contacts. Aleksandr Lukashenko invited Emomali Rahmon to pay a working visit to Belarus for the session of the CSTO Collective Security Council in Minsk. It was noted that the visit will help promote trustworthy political dialogue, will give an impetus to the trade and economic relations and expand the legal framework.

    Besides, during the telephone conversation the leaders of the two countries discussed issues on the international and regional agenda.

    The Belarusian head of state wished happy birthday to his Tajikistan counterpart. Aleksandr Lukashenko stressed that Tajikistan managed to preserve its integrity and independence, make considerable achievements in the social and economic development and strengthen its authority on the international arena. Emomali Rahmon has made a big contribution to it.
